    Requirements

    Car key programming is the process of connecting an electronic car key fob to your vehicle to allow it to open and start your vehicle. It is a very useful technology since it makes it difficult for thieves to steal your car since they are unable to use a programmed car key to start or unlock your car. It also allows you to store multiple key fobs in a single remote, so you don't have to carry around several keys.

    Modern cars have transponder chips in their key fobs which communicate with the vehicle's system to identify the driver and start the engine. The transponder chip is a distinct coded signal that the vehicle reads to confirm the key fob's identity. The vehicle must match the unique code signal to the correct keyfob to program an entirely new one. This can be accomplished by using a key programming tool that communicates with the vehicle in order to clone the key and then transmits a code to a new key fob. Some vehicles may require the module or EEPROM chip to be removed from the vehicle for programming, however, other key programs can be created directly via an J2534 interface.

    Before you begin reprogramming your car key, make sure that you have two functioning keys in your possession. One key is required to link the new car fob to your car's system, and the other will be needed to turn on and off your ignition. Refer to the owner's guide in case you're not acquainted with the anti-theft features of your vehicle. You may need to take additional steps in order to connect a key to your system. You can also search the internet for the model of your car and make to locate the instructions that are specific to your vehicle. If needed, locksmiths and auto repair shops can assist you in reprogramming your car's key fob. This can help you avoid damage to the electronics of your car and also save you money on replacing your key with a costly one. Some companies also offer guarantees on their work, so you can be confident that your vehicle will be protected from an unauthorized access.

    Time

    In the past, metal car keys relied on fresh-cut teeth to turn physical tumblers which opened car key fob programming near me door locks and operated the ignition. Transponders for smart car keys have replaced these conventional keys. Each key fob contains a computer chip that communicates with the vehicle's system. Transponder keys that are lost or stolen should be programmed by an locksmith or mechanic to allow the car to start. The process takes anywhere from 30 minutes to an hour for the majority of automobiles. But, there's a novel method of getting your car's key reset in under 10 minutes.

    Safety

    As you may have guessed, reprogramming the car key isn't something that should be attempted at home. This is the responsibility of an expert locksmith or auto technician. They have the tools needed to complete the task, in addition to their knowledge about the transponder chip in car keys. This includes key cutting machines and the programming device. They may be able to find a functioning chip inside your old key and reprogram it with that. This is only possible using a key that's been properly cut by a certified locksmith and that was originally designed to work with your vehicle's model, make and year.

    In most cases, you can do this using a device called an "EEPROM key programmer." This is a complicated process that requires you to remove modules from your car to bypass the anti-theft device and enter the programming mode. This is a complex and costly process that must be handled by professionals.

    Another option to save money on changing the damaged key head with a brand new blank key shell. This is cheaper than buying the new key and will still allow you to start your vehicle. But, you must transfer all the internals from the broken key head to the new key shell, including the transponder.
